Hướng dẫn Mô hình hóa ArchiMate: Các Thực hành Tốt nhất để Tạo Sơ đồ Rõ ràng và Súc tích

Kiến trúc doanh nghiệp đòi hỏi hơn cả việc tập hợp các mô hình; nó cần một ngôn ngữ mà các bên liên quan có thể hiểu và tin tưởng. ArchiMate cung cấp ngôn ngữ đó, mang đến cách tiếp cận có cấu trúc để trực quan hóa, phân tích và thiết kế các tổ chức phức tạp. Tuy nhiên, sức mạnh của phương pháp nằm không ở các biểu tượng bản thân chúng, mà ở cách chúng được áp dụng. Một sơ đồ rối rắm sẽ gây nhầm lẫn; một mô hình được cấu trúc tốt sẽ làm rõ vấn đề.

Hướng dẫn này nêu rõ các thực hành thiết yếu để tạo ra các sơ đồ ArchiMate truyền đạt hiệu quả. Chúng ta sẽ khám phá cách duy trì tính nhất quán giữa các lớp, lựa chọn các góc nhìn phù hợp, và tránh những sai lầm mô hình hóa phổ biến làm giảm giá trị công việc kiến trúc của bạn.

Kawaii-style infographic illustrating ArchiMate modeling best practices: four core layers (Business, Application, Technology, Strategy), stakeholder viewpoints, visual consistency tips, relationship types, motivation layer integration, common pitfalls to avoid, and quality review checklist, designed with cute pastel aesthetics for clear enterprise architecture communication

🧱 Hiểu rõ Các Lớp Cốt lõi

Nền tảng của ArchiMate là cấu trúc theo lớp. Sự tách biệt về vấn đề này cho phép các kiến trúc sư tập trung vào các khía cạnh cụ thể của doanh nghiệp mà không mất đi bối cảnh tổng thể. Tuân thủ các ranh giới lớp là điều cần thiết để đảm bảo sự rõ ràng.

  • Lớp Kinh doanh: Tập trung vào cấu trúc kinh doanh, các quy trình kinh doanh và các dịch vụ kinh doanh. Đây là nơi định nghĩa chiến lược và chuỗi giá trị của tổ chức.
  • Lớp Ứng dụng: Mô tả các ứng dụng hỗ trợ các quy trình kinh doanh. Nó nhấn mạnh các hệ thống phần mềm, dữ liệu và giao diện người dùng.
  • Lớp Công nghệ: Chi tiết về cơ sở hạ tầng vật lý và logic chạy các ứng dụng. Bao gồm phần cứng, mạng lưới và môi trường triển khai.
  • Lớp Chiến lược: Kết nối các lớp cốt lõi với động lực của doanh nghiệp. Bao gồm các mục tiêu, nguyên tắc và yêu cầu.

Khi tạo sơ đồ, hãy tự hỏi lớp nào là trọng tâm chính. Việc trộn quá nhiều lớp mà không có mục đích rõ ràng có thể dẫn đến quá tải nhận thức. Ví dụ, một cái nhìn chiến lược cấp cao không nên đi sâu vào cấu hình phần cứng cụ thể của lớp công nghệ trừ khi chi tiết đó là then chốt cho quyết định đang được đưa ra.

🗺️ Chọn Các Góc Nhìn Phù hợp

Một sơ đồ duy nhất không thể hiển thị mọi thứ. Các bên liên quan khác nhau cần thông tin khác nhau. Các góc nhìn xác định góc nhìn từ đó một bản xem được xây dựng. Việc chọn đúng góc nhìn đảm bảo rằng đối tượng đúng sẽ nhận được thông tin đúng.

Góc nhìn Đối tượng chính Vùng tập trung
Quy trình Kinh doanh Nhà quản lý Kinh doanh Luồng công việc và các hoạt động
Sử dụng Ứng dụng Nhà quản lý CNTT Hỗ trợ phần mềm cho các quy trình
Triển khai Đội ngũ Cơ sở hạ tầng Kiến trúc vật lý
Thực hiện Mục tiêu Ban Chiến lược Sự đồng bộ hóa các hành động với mục tiêu

Khi mô hình hóa, đừng mặc định sử dụng một góc nhìn chung duy nhất. Thay vào đó, hãy điều chỉnh sơ đồ cho phù hợp với câu hỏi cụ thể đang được đặt ra. Nếu câu hỏi là “Hệ thống thất bại như thế nào?”, có thể cần đến góc nhìn triển khai công nghệ. Nếu câu hỏi là “Chi phí thay đổi là bao nhiêu?”, thì góc nhìn năng lực kinh doanh sẽ phù hợp hơn.

Để đảm bảo tính nhất quán, hãy xác định một bộ các góc nhìn chuẩn cho tổ chức của bạn. Điều này ngăn chặn việc mỗi kiến trúc sư tự thiết kế phong cách ký hiệu riêng, điều này sẽ gây ra sự phân mảnh trong kho lưu trữ kiến trúc doanh nghiệp.

🎨 Tính nhất quán và tiêu chuẩn trực quan

Tính rõ ràng thường là vấn đề của sự kỷ luật trực quan. Khi bất kỳ ai nhìn vào sơ đồ của bạn, họ nên hiểu ngay lập tức ý nghĩa của các hình dạng và màu sắc mà không cần đến chú thích. Tính nhất quán giúp giảm thời gian cần thiết để hiểu mô hình.

Mã màu

Mặc dù ArchiMate cho phép linh hoạt, nhưng việc sử dụng màu sắc để chỉ các lớp hoặc các loại phần tử cụ thể sẽ giúp việc quét hình trực quan dễ dàng hơn. Ví dụ, việc nhất quán sử dụng màu xanh cho các phần tử kinh doanh và màu xanh lá cho các phần tử công nghệ sẽ tạo ra một bản đồ tư duy cho người đọc. Tuy nhiên, đừng chỉ dựa vào màu sắc, vì một số bên liên quan có thể bị khiếm khuyết thị giác màu. Hãy sử dụng hình dạng hoặc nhãn văn bản làm phương tiện nhận diện chính.

Quy ước gán nhãn

Tên phải mang tính mô tả và nhất quán. Tránh dùng các chữ viết tắt trừ khi chúng được chuẩn hóa trên toàn doanh nghiệp. Ví dụ, hãy dùng “Hệ thống quản lý khách hàng” thay vì “CMS”. Điều này tránh gây nhầm lẫn với các viết tắt phổ biến khác. Đảm bảo rằng mỗi phần tử đều có một định danh hoặc tên duy nhất trong bối cảnh của mô hình.

  • Sử dụng chữ hoa đầu từ:Duy trì phong cách viết hoa nhất quán cho tất cả các nhãn.
  • Tránh lặp lại:Nếu một phần tử được đặt tên là “Quy trình Dịch vụ Khách hàng”, đừng gán nhãn cho hoạt động liên quan là “Xử lý Dịch vụ Khách hàng”. Hãy ngắn gọn.
  • Nhãn có bối cảnh:Đảm bảo nhãn có ý nghĩa trong sơ đồ. Một nhãn chung chung như “Hệ thống” sẽ ít hữu ích hơn so với “Động cơ xử lý đơn hàng”.

🔗 Quản lý mối quan hệ hiệu quả

ArchiMate định nghĩa 12 loại mối quan hệ. Những đường nối này kết nối các phần tử và kể nên câu chuyện về kiến trúc. Việc lạm dụng mối quan hệ hoặc sử dụng sai loại có thể biến sơ đồ thành một mạng lưới rối rắm.

Các loại mối quan hệ phổ biến

  • Liên kết:Một liên kết chung giữa hai phần tử. Sử dụng điều này một cách tiết chế.
  • Dòng chảy:Chỉ ra sự di chuyển của thông tin hoặc vật liệu giữa các đối tượng.
  • Thực hiện:Chỉ ra cách một phần tử triển khai hoặc thực hiện phần tử khác.
  • Truy cập:Chỉ ra rằng một đối tượng sử dụng hoặc truy cập một đối tượng khác.
  • Giao nhiệm vụ:Chỉ ra việc giao một vai trò cho một tác nhân hoặc một quy trình.

Khi vẽ các đường nối, hãy tránh giao nhau một cách không cần thiết. Các đường giao nhau làm tăng tải nhận thức và khiến sơ đồ khó theo dõi hơn. Nếu một mối quan hệ buộc phải vượt qua ranh giới, hãy sử dụng chú thích hoặc uốn cong để làm rõ đường đi. Sử dụng các đường vuông góc (các đoạn thẳng nằm ngang và dọc) thay vì đường chéo để duy trì vẻ ngoài sạch sẽ, giống như lưới.

Hướng của mối quan hệ

Các mối quan hệ thường có hướng. Đảm bảo các đầu mũi tên hiển thị rõ ràng và chỉ theo hướng hợp lý của luồng hoặc phụ thuộc. Một sai lầm phổ biến là vẽ các đường không định hướng khi tồn tại một mối phụ thuộc cụ thể. Nếu phần tử A phụ thuộc vào phần tử B, mũi tên phải chỉ từ A sang B để thể hiện hướng phụ thuộc.

🎯 Kết hợp lớp Động lực

Kiến trúc không có động lực chỉ là một bản đồ không có điểm đến. Lớp Động lực giải thíchtại sao doanh nghiệp được cấu trúc theo cách như vậy. Lớp này bao gồm Mục tiêu, Nguyên tắc, Yêu cầu và Động lực.

Việc tích hợp lớp này vào sơ đồ của bạn giúp các bên liên quan hiểu được lý do đằng sau các quyết định kiến trúc. Ví dụ, nếu bạn đề xuất một ứng dụng mới, hãy hiển thị Mục tiêu mà nó hỗ trợ. Nếu bạn loại bỏ một quy trình, hãy hiển thị Nguyên tắc thúc đẩy việc loại bỏ đó.

  • Mục tiêu: Các mục tiêu cấp cao mà doanh nghiệp muốn đạt được.
  • Nguyên tắc: Các quy tắc hướng dẫn việc ra quyết định.
  • Yêu cầu: Các nhu cầu cụ thể phải được đáp ứng.
  • Động lực: Các yếu tố bên ngoài hoặc bên trong ảnh hưởng đến doanh nghiệp.

Khi mô hình hóa, hãy cố gắng liên kết các lớp cốt lõi (Kinh doanh, Ứng dụng, Công nghệ) với lớp Động lực. Điều này tạo thành chuỗi truy xuất nguồn gốc. Nếu một yêu cầu không được liên kết với bất kỳ phần tử kiến trúc nào, có thể cho thấy sự thiếu hụt trong thiết kế. Nếu một phần tử không được liên kết với bất kỳ mục tiêu nào, có thể là ứng cử viên cho việc loại bỏ.

🛑 Những sai lầm phổ biến cần tránh

Ngay cả các kiến trúc sư có kinh nghiệm cũng có thể rơi vào những cái bẫy làm giảm chất lượng mô hình của họ. Nhận thức về những vấn đề phổ biến này giúp duy trì các tiêu chuẩn cao.

1. Bẫy ‘Tổng quan lớn’

Cố gắng thể hiện toàn bộ doanh nghiệp trong một sơ đồ duy nhất là con đường dẫn đến thảm họa. Độ phức tạp tăng vọt nhanh chóng, và sơ đồ trở nên không thể đọc được. Chia nhỏ các mô hình lớn thành các góc nhìn nhỏ hơn, dễ quản lý. Sử dụng kỹ thuật phóng to, nơi một bản đồ cấp cao liên kết với bản đồ chi tiết, thay vì nhồi nhét quá nhiều chi tiết vào sơ đồ chính.

2. Mô hình hóa quá mức

Mô hình hóa mọi mối quan hệ và phần tử riêng lẻ có thể tạo ra một mô hình quá chi tiết đến mức không còn hữu ích. Hãy tập trung vào những phần tử thực sự quan trọng trong bối cảnh cụ thể của sơ đồ. Nếu một chi tiết không giúp trả lời câu hỏi của bên liên quan, thường có thể bỏ qua.

3. Bỏ qua bối cảnh

Sơ đồ không nên tồn tại trong trạng thái trống rỗng. Đảm bảo bối cảnh của sơ đồ là rõ ràng. Đây có phải là cái nhìn toàn bộ tổ chức hay chỉ một bộ phận cụ thể? Đây là trạng thái tương lai hay hiện tại? Luôn luôn bao gồm tiêu đề rõ ràng và, nếu cần, mô tả ngắn gọn về phạm vi.

4. Đặt tên không nhất quán

Nếu một phần của mô hình dùng ‘Quy trình’ và phần khác dùng ‘Hoạt động’ cho cùng một khái niệm, mô hình sẽ trở nên gây nhầm lẫn. Xây dựng một từ điển thuật ngữ và áp dụng thống nhất trên tất cả các mô hình. Điều này đảm bảo rằng khi một bên liên quan tìm kiếm một thuật ngữ, họ sẽ nhận được kết quả nhất quán.

🔄 Bảo trì và Quản lý

Một mô hình kiến trúc là một tác phẩm sống động. Nó đòi hỏi bảo trì để duy trì tính phù hợp. Không có quản lý, các mô hình sẽ lệch khỏi thực tế, và giá trị của chúng dần suy giảm theo thời gian.

  • Kiểm soát phiên bản: Theo dõi các thay đổi đối với mô hình. Biết được thời điểm ra quyết định và ai là người ra quyết định là điều rất quan trọng cho kiểm toán và tham khảo trong tương lai.
  • Vòng kiểm tra: Lên lịch xem xét định kỳ kiến trúc. Đảm bảo các mô hình phản ánh trạng thái hiện tại của doanh nghiệp.
  • Quản lý thay đổi: Khi một thay đổi được đề xuất, cập nhật mô hình để phản ánh tác động. Điều này có thể bao gồm cập nhật các mối quan hệ, thêm các thành phần mới hoặc loại bỏ các thành phần cũ.
  • Phản hồi từ các bên liên quan: Thường xuyên tìm kiếm phản hồi từ người dùng sơ đồ. Nếu họ thấy một sơ đồ gây nhầm lẫn, hãy hỏi lý do và điều chỉnh cách trực quan hóa.

Tài liệu là một phần của mô hình. Bao gồm các ghi chú giải thích các mối quan hệ phức tạp hoặc các quyết định không rõ ràng chỉ từ sơ đồ. Những chú thích này cung cấp bối cảnh cần thiết cho các kiến trúc sư tương lai, những người có thể không có mặt khi thiết kế ban đầu được tạo ra.

📊 Cấu trúc hóa thông tin phức tạp

Khi xử lý các tình huống phức tạp, cấu trúc là chìa khóa. Sử dụng các kỹ thuật nhóm để tổ chức các thành phần liên quan. Một nhóm có thể đại diện cho một đơn vị kinh doanh cụ thể, một dự án cụ thể hoặc một khoảng thời gian cụ thể.

Sử dụng nhúng cẩn trọng. Nhúng các thành phần vào bên trong các thành phần khác có thể thể hiện mối quan hệ bao hàm, nhưng quá nhiều mức nhúng sẽ che giấu các mối quan hệ. Nếu một thành phần được nhúng bên trong thành phần khác, hãy đảm bảo mối quan hệ này là có chủ đích và mang ý nghĩa. Không sử dụng nhúng chỉ để sắp xếp không gian trên bảng vẽ.

Cân nhắc sử dụng các làn đường (swimlanes) cho các quy trình. Các làn đường rõ ràng tách biệt trách nhiệm giữa các vai trò hoặc bộ phận khác nhau. Điều này giúp dễ dàng nhận thấy các điểm chuyển giao và nơi có thể xảy ra điểm nghẽn. Ví dụ, một sơ đồ làn đường có thể hiển thị luồng yêu cầu từ làn “Khách hàng” sang làn “Bán hàng”, rồi đến làn “Thực hiện.”

🔍 Kiểm tra chất lượng

Trước khi hoàn tất một sơ đồ, hãy thực hiện kiểm tra chất lượng. Đây là một bước đơn giản giúp ngăn ngừa lỗi lan rộng đến các bên liên quan.

  • Kiểm tra ngữ pháp: Đảm bảo tất cả các mối quan hệ đều hợp lệ theo quy định của ArchiMate. Một số kết nối không được phép giữa các loại thành phần nhất định.
  • Kiểm tra tính đầy đủ: Tất cả các thành phần cần thiết có mặt chưa? Có điểm bắt đầu và kết thúc cho luồng không?
  • Kiểm tra tính dễ đọc: Người mới có thể hiểu sơ đồ mà không cần hỏi câu hỏi không? Nếu không, hãy đơn giản hóa.
  • Kiểm tra sự đồng bộ: Các sơ đồ có phù hợp với mục tiêu chiến lược không? Có đường nhìn rõ ràng từ công nghệ lên đến giá trị kinh doanh không?

Bằng cách tuân thủ các thực hành này, bạn đảm bảo rằng các mô hình ArchiMate của mình phục vụ mục đích chính: giao tiếp. Một sơ đồ tốt nói to hơn ngàn lời. Nó cung cấp sự hiểu biết chung về doanh nghiệp, giúp đưa ra quyết định tốt hơn và thực hiện chiến lược hiệu quả hơn.

Mục tiêu không chỉ là tạo ra một mô hình, mà là tạo ra một mô hình hoạt động hiệu quả. Nó nên là một công cụ mà các kiến trúc sư, nhà quản lý và nhà phát triển có thể sử dụng để định hướng trong sự phức tạp của tổ chức. Với kỷ luật, nhất quán và tập trung vào sự rõ ràng, ArchiMate trở thành một tài sản mạnh mẽ cho chuyển đổi doanh nghiệp.